how can I remove this red piece without damaging the grill??


Is it plastic red or metal??

plastic, it's clipped on, go slowly, it helps if you remove the grille first.

^ This, be very carefully it will break easy just take your time. If you break it your pretty much screwed and will not find a replacement easily.

Remove the top grill. Find something skinny (like a flathead or pry tool) and separate the black clip from the red and push it out slowly.
I did this when it was below freezing out and it was so cold and brittle it broke into four pieces :frown:
Just go slow and be patient.

Just some pointers , when i painted my grill stripe i actually started from the center and worked my way outwards
I used an ice pick my pops had lying around in his garage to help push them out. Actually they are in there really good

Be careful putting them back in cause you can break the tabs that way to..i got lucky and only broke two Lol
